Experiencing issues with your Miele dishwasher's circulation pump? Frequent signs of a failing unit can include poor rinse flow, excessive sounds, or a total absence of cleaning. Initial troubleshooting procedures involve checking for obvious blockages in the filter and ensuring the power to the machine is adequate. If such basic checks don't resolve the situation, a replacement circulation pump might be necessary. Be sure to consult your Miele appliance's manual or contact professional help before attempting any fix.

Miele Wash Pump Failure: Causes, Symptoms, and Solutions
A frequent appliance wash motor issue can be a troublesome experience. Several causes can lead to this defect. Objects like small clothing are a primary factor, as they can block the pump. Additionally, scale, over time, can damage the pump's mechanisms. Indications typically include a noticeable grinding noise during the wash cycle, water not emptying properly, or an message displayed on the display. Solutions range from manually removing any obstructions to get more info replacing the broken pump itself. A qualified repair person is recommended for more complex repairs to ensure proper assessment and solution.
Replacing a Faulty Miele Circulation Pump – A Step-by-Step Guide
Dealing with a malfunctioning Miele dishwasher? A typical culprit is a worn-out circulation pump. This guide will help you the process of swapping it. First, turn off the power supply to your appliance. Next, find the pump – it’s usually positioned at the bottom of the machine. You’ll require a screwdriver (often a Phillips head) to loosen the wiring connections and any securing brackets. Carefully remove the old pump, noting its orientation for proper setup of the substitute unit. Finally, attach the new pump in reverse order, ensuring all wires are firmly attached before restoring power. Remember to consult your Miele’s specific instructions for model-specific details, as procedures may slightly vary .
